Hi there i am wondering why this product does not give me all my ram: Shouldn't you get to see all your ram when you install a 64-bit Vista (Home Premium)? Apparently not always as freitasm pointed out before. ARRRGH

In the preinstalled 32-bit version, 2GB ram shows as 1.93GB, and 3GB ram shows as 2.86GB. Installing 64-bit vista versions did not give me the 2.99GB ram as i hoped for. Does that mean there's no point getting 4GB of ram as the hardware is a limiting factor for even the 64-bit versions to recognise all the ram?

I tried for brain sake also installed without licence 64-bit business and ultimate versions and then wiping them - no change.

Try a BIOS upgrade, I had an Acer laptop that would only recognise 2.8GB of 4GB until they released a BIOS update that allowed it to see the full 4GB.
